Description

• The Account Manager is responsible for partnering with the Director of Account Management to build, execute, deliver, and measure client programs and campaigns that build long-term client relationships and deliver client business goals. • This role is also accountable for managing the delivery of assigned client work on strategy, time, and budget working cross-functionally. • The Account Manager will work closely with the Director, Account Management, and cross-functionally with the operations team to support the development and set up of client plans and programs, including strategy/insights, targeting, segmentation and personas, customer journeys, messaging, and creative direction. • Leads periodic client review meetings for assigned clients keeping the client informed on the strategy, the linqd. value to the client, and the program metrics.

Requirements

• At least three years of experience in an account management role working in an Agency, Consultancy, or marketing role in a B2B, B2C, or preferably a B2B2C company. • Prefer building industry experience or related multi-channel/multi-audience industry (B2B2C). • Marketing-related background, including product or brand management support experience. • Understanding of digital with the ability to talk in an informed manner about marketing programs. • Ability to analyze program metrics and provide insights and optimization recommendations to the team or client. • Proficient in Microsoft 365, with strong skills in data analysis using Excel and data visualization tools such as Tableau. • Experienced in using CRMs, including Salesforce and HubSpot. • Forward-thinking and proactive, with the ability to anticipate needs and act without waiting for instructions. • Must understand or learn the industry, market, and product/service trends affecting our client’s competitiveness. • Exceptional interpersonal skills, leadership by example. • Personal and team organizational, project-management, and time-management skills. • Ability to work under pressure whilst maintaining a cool outlook. • Thriving in an environment that never stops is a must. • A personable and professional character that will allow you to build client rapport.
